Queens Park Rangers to sign South Korean Yun Suk-Young

South Korean international Yun Suk-Young is reportedly due to have a medical in London ahead of a move to Queens Park Rangers.

Queens Park Rangers are reportedly edging closer to signing South Korean defender Yun Suk-Young from Chunnam Dragons.

The 22-year-old is expected to sign a deal with the West London outfit, who currently sit at the bottom of the Premier League table.

A statement on the Chunnam Dragons' website said: "He is expected to sign a contract with the QPR if he passes the test."

The South Korea international is due to fly to the capital today to undergo a medical ahead of a proposed move, according to Sky Sports News.

Yun played in England during the Olympic Games with his country.
